The phrase "argue for months"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to describe a situation where a discussion or debate continues over an extended period of time, typically involving differing opinions or perspectives.
Example: "They continued to argue for months about the best approach to solve the issue, but they never reached a consensus."
Alternatives: "debate for months" or "dispute for months".
